dragracer502 10-25-2010 11:15 AM

Re: "THE DUTCH" the real "big go" for stock / super stock Who's In?
 
Well, it was all we could hope it would be! Awesome weather, fast runs, good times and lots of laughs. Can Am was strongly represented, The Emes Team, Wally Clark, Vic Belemy, Brian Westbrook, Bill Little, and "Young" Robby Becker. Gene and Ken both made realy fast runs in their classes and let everyone see the type of high quality, well prepaired cars that come from Can Am, Brian is the new record holder in T/Stk (way to go), Vic strapped several .00 lights on his competitors going 3 rounds into an very tough Stock field (the old guy still has a few in him it seems), Wally was tough as always and took out several top racers from across the country in SS (not bad for a guy who learned to drive from the wrong side of a car), Bill was lights out going to the semi finals in a SS field of 88 (and winning the mileage award for travelling from his "house on the hill" to the starting line), Robby over came all the odds, and running his very well prepaired Camaro in "bracket mode" knocked out the #1 and #2 cars in the class to win, and followed that up by going 4 rounds deep on Sunday ( results fitting of a champion, way to go Rob). Lets double our series attendance at the Dutch for next year and see Can Am cars in the finals of Stk and SS
